    Looking for thoughts on this. Feel free to tell me if it's dumb, weird, smart, whatever haha. But I am tired of breaking inner tie rods while wheeling (more rock climbing and trail riding than the go fast stuff). So I figured I would borrow the idea of heim steering but use a fj80 tie rod end. My theory is it will still have a weak point for failure if I get bound up to much, be easy for maintenence, and it is something autopart stores will have if I ever need one in a hurry.
    20180910_195107.jpg
    I did have to drill my spindle out and make a bushing to match the new taper but I'm willing to try it. Thanks for your inputs and hoping I thought of everything but you guys are a lot smarter than me haha
